Congratulations to Kaili Xiao of Chino Hills, CA, for winning the 2025 Women’s California State Open Presented by Toyota, finishing the 54-hole Championship at 7-under-par at Desert Springs Golf Course. Xiao posted rounds of 70-68-71 to withstand the 140-player field and walked away with the trophy. Her name is now the tenth name etched into the Championship’s history books with the likes of Brianna Do, Haley Moore, Alana Uriell, and other past champions.
Congratulations also to Shelly Stouffer of Nanoose Bay, British Columbia, for claiming the title in the Senior Division with a score of one-over-par (69-74-74). Stouffer becomes the second player to win the Senior Division, as Pat Hurst, PGA, won the inaugural title in 2024.

SCPGA Catalyst Series
The Southern California PGA is excited to evolve the Catalyst Webinar Series in 2026 to better support the professional growth of our PGA Members and Associates.
Catalyst Sessions will be conducted twice monthly on the 1st and 3rd Thursday from 8am-9am PST (unless otherwise noted), offering focused content on topics that matter most to PGA Professionals – like teaching excellence, business strategy, finance, governance, motivation, and more. This updated format is designed to deliver clear, actionable takeaways to help those become an even more impactful and successful PGA Professional. All PGA Professionals are invited and welcome to attend these educational webinars. PDR Credits are available for attending the live sessions.
